计算机区间的值VB表达式,第2章 节 基本数据类型与表达式 计算机等级考试之VB程序设计课件.ppt...

第2章 节 基本数据类型与表达式 计算机等级考试之VB程序设计课件.ppt

第 2 章 基本数据类型与表达式;语法单位的形成规则称为“语法规则”。每种程序设计语言都是一个语法规则,按照它可以描述数据,处理数据,并构成解决特定问题的程序。程序是由一条条语句构成的。语句是由单词和表达式构成,单词和表达式是由字符组成。在程序设计语言中,字符、词汇、表达式、语句、过程、函数等统称为“语法单位”。; 字符是构成程序设计语言的最基本符号。每一种程序设计语言都有自己的字符集。程序设计语言中的合法句子都是由这个字符集上的字符构成的集合。; 在VB中,汉字既可以作为变量名,有语法意义,也可以作为字符显示或打印出来。 这些符号作为语言成分是由ASCII码翻译成机器代码的。 在程序代码窗口中输入程序时,汉字在中文方式下输入,其它字符必须在英文方式下输入。 例如,输入语句 Print " 圆面积是:", 3.14159 * r * r ; “单词”是程序设计语言中具有独立意义的最基本结构。 例如:0.5是一个单词,表示值为0.5的实型常数。 程序设计语言中,单词符号一般包括:运算符、界符、关键字、标识符、各类型常数等。 ; (4)逻辑运算符 NOT(逻辑非) AND(逻辑与) OR (逻辑或) Xor (异或) Eqv (等价) Imp(蕴涵) ;(5)其他界符 ( (左圆括号) )(右圆括号) [ (左方括号) ] (右方括号) , (逗号) ; (分号) : (冒号) ! (感叹号) ? (问号) “ (双引号) ‘ (单引号) . (小数点) % (百分号) # (井号) _ (下划线) Space (空格) $ (货币符或字符串类型符) ; 关键字又称保留字。在语法上具有固定含义的单词称为关键字,它是语句的重要组成部分。它也用来表示系统提供的标准过程、函数、运算符、常量等。例如: ; 标识符用于标记用户自定义的常量、类型、变量、控件或过程、函数等。标识符的选取必须遵循如下规则: · 必须以字母开头,由字母、数字和下划线组成。 · 变量名的最后一个字符可以是类型说明符。 · 不能超过255个字符。 控件、窗体、类和模块的名字不能超过40个字符。 · 不能和关键字同名(但窗体和控件名除外)。; 另外,也允许使用汉字作为用户自定义的标识符。 例如, 合法的标识符有:a x1 n0_1 a2c sum% name myform 姓名 班级 不合法标识符有:2a x+y ? ? a,b a$b print 标识符的选取除了符合上述原则外,应该尽可能做到“见名知义”,提高程序的可读性。 例如,年龄用age,名字用name,总和用sum ; 数据是程序的处理对象,它有不同类型。VB提供的基本数据类型主要有字符串型、数值型、逻辑型和日期型。不同类型的数据的表示形式、取值范围和操作方式都不一样。; 字符串(String)是一个字符序列,由放在一对双引号中的ASCII字符(除双引号和回车符之外)、汉字及其他可打印字符组成。 ; (1)字符串中包含的字符个数称为字符串长度。在Visual Basic 6.0中,把汉字作为一个字符处理。长度为0(即不含任何字符)的字符串称为空字符串,简称为空串。; 整型数是不带小数点和指数符号的数。十进制整型数由 0~9 之间的数字组成,可以带正号或负号。 例如: 147588565 200 –3145 32700 整型数按示数表示范围的不同分为整数、长整数和字节型整数。整型数和长整数还可以有三种表示形式:十进制、八进制和十六进制形式。;(1)整型(Integer) 十进制整数以两个字节(16位)二进制码表示和参与运算,其取值范围是–32768 ~ +32767。 八进制整数由八进制数字0~7组成,前面冠以&或&0,可以带正号或负号。其取值的绝对值范围是&0

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值